Famous People Who Look Like Animals: Why We See Human-Animal Resemblance

Why We See Human-Animal Lookalikes

People often comment that certain famous faces resemble animals, from cats and dogs to foxes, birds, and monkeys. These impressions arise from how our visual system extracts features like nose shape, eye spacing, brow structure, skin tone, hair texture, and facial ratios, then maps them onto familiar animal prototypes. Pareidolia and categorical perception amplify matches when viewers focus on partial cues. Strong resemblance claims typically combine structural facial metrics, lighting, pose, and cultural naming rather than biological similarity. Below we break down how these perceptions form, which facial traits matter most, and how to evaluate them without overstating meaning.

How Face Perception Creates Animal Matches

Human and animal face processing share tuned detectors for configural spacing—distances between eyes, nose to mouth, and outline curvature. When a human face aligns with a schematic template, subtle metric deviations can accentuate animal-like impressions. For example, wider set eyes may cue avian or fox-like patterns; a longer midface can echo canine snouts; a pointed chin or upturned nose may echo beak shapes. The same neural circuits that support species recognition in nature also support rapid person categorization, making animal analogies feel intuitive.

  • Configuration over isolated traits: spacing and ratios drive impressions more than single features.
  • Prototype matching: brains compare faces to stored animal averages.
  • Contextual cues: hairstyle, accessories, and lighting alter contrast and highlight certain cues.

Feature-Level Shaping of Animal-Like Impressions

Specific facial landmarks often anchor resemblance claims. Eye shape and crease patterns can evoke feline or vulpine traits; nasal bridge steepness and tip projection affect animal length metrics; lip thickness and jaw angle contribute to broader or narrower silhouettes. Skin texture, visible pores, and complexion uniformity further steer impressions toward soft, fur-like, or scaled appearances. Names and roles prime expectations: labels such as ‘Cat’ or ‘Bird’ encourage selective noticing of confirming cues, while ignoring non-matching details.

Key Drivers of the 'Looks Like' Effect

Beyond static landmarks, dynamic and contextual factors shape why a famous person might be said to look like an animal. Motion, expression, and vocal timing influence perceived energy, while naming conventions supply ready-made metaphors. Cultural narratives and prior exposure prime certain matches, making some associations more likely to stick. Recognizing these forces helps separate perceptual patterns from literal resemblance, ensuring that comparisons remain descriptive rather than deterministic.

Evaluating Resemblance Claims Rationally

To assess whether a famous person looks like a specific animal, apply a checklist focused on measurable cues and avoids overgeneralization. Start by listing the facial metrics noted in credible descriptions, then map them to species-specific traits using reference imagery. Note the role of naming, lighting, and angle in shaping impression strength. This structured approach clarifies which elements are genuinely salient versus those amplified by suggestion or stereotype.

  • Define the claimed animal and target features.
  • Collect high-quality, neutral images of the person.
  • Compare spacing ratios and contour shapes to species references.
  • Acknowledge lighting, angle, and naming influence.

Limitations and Responsible Interpretation

Human–animal resemblance is inherently subjective and rooted in pattern completion. Reliable accounts should cite visible metrics and avoid implying genetic or functional links, given that appearance does not indicate biology or behavior. Responsible commentary treats such observations as perceptual curiosities rather than taxonomic evidence, and clarifies that names and roles can exaggerate selective attention. Clear framing protects against misleading implications while still honoring the insight people find in pattern-based likenesses.
